Learning, No Matter where You Are: Q&A with Chris Dede
Crow, Tracy
Journal of Staff Development, v31 n1 p10-12, 14, 16-17 Feb 2010
This article presents an interview with Chris Dede, the Timothy E. Wirth Professor in Learning Technologies at the Harvard Graduate School of Education. His research interests include the use of emerging technologies in education, with emphases on online professional development, scaling up innovations, and immersive interfaces for learning. He is a frequent speaker for education, research, and policy audiences. In this interview, Dede discusses the merits of online vs. face-to-face professional development.
